Schoolgirls get a taste of the ‘ADF Experience’
Attracting new recruits to refresh the ranks of the Australian Defence Force is constant job.
An increasing number of women and girls are considering careers in the Army, Navy and Air Force.
Over two days this week 40 year 10, 11 and 12 female students will get a taste of the military life attending the ‘ADF Experience’ event at Gallipoli Barracks.
Captain Karina Harvey is a Specialist Recruiter for Women and she tells Mark a military career can offer much to young women.
